"Spanning nearly sixty years, Nina Cassian's poems - both new English compositions and translations from Romanian - blend her gallows humor and an engagement with the human experience. Her poems explore everything from the absurdities of modern life to our discomfort with death and loss - and in so doing, they vividly portray complex emotion. Here is an elegy on Bach and a brief meditation on Beckett, on loneliness, on the concurrent tenderness and severity of seasons, and on the intensity of feeling a lover's back."--BOOK JACKET.
